    Aurora has had several songs in movies/series, like for example:
    “Running with the wolves” in Wolfwalkers
    “My sails are set” in One Piece
    “Through the eyes of a child” in The 100
    “Runaway” in The following
    “Midas touch” in Hanna
    “The secret garden” in The secret garden
    “Hunting Shadows” in the game Assassins Creed
    She was “the voice” in “Into the unknown” from Frozen 2
    She’s also sings in most of the songs by Hans Zimmer in Frozen Planet 2
